自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(92)
  • 资源 (9)
  • 收藏
  • 关注

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(7)周所学知识(PF-TBD感悟:纯干货,全网你绝对搜不到下面的干货)

若由本篇博文增加关注,就解封本篇博文的VIP权限哈,记得在下方留言哈本周上点对于基于PF-TBD的雷达目标跟踪的超级干货。下面的这些全网搜索都不一定找得到(至少我看了许多的博文与文献还没有下面的这些总结)!目前网上流传的那些pf-tbd的全都是在仿真的数据上进行的,导致在编码时不知不觉的就用到了仿真的信息,而这些信息,如果在真实的雷达回波中你是不知道滴!重采样有均匀重采样和最小方差重采样,...

2020-04-30 21:16:18 2038 9

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(6)周所学知识(002)

若由本篇博文增加关注,就解封本篇博文的VIP权限哈,记得在下方留言哈5. 重采样为什么需要重采样?因为在实际应用SIS的过程中,我们发现出现了粒子退化现象:即经过多次迭代后,假设100个粒子,其中有1的粒子的归一化权值为0.99,而另外的99个粒子之和才0.01,这将会造成目标跟踪的失败。解决办法有啥呢:1.选取好的重要性概率密度函数;2.重采样。什么叫做重采样,重采样就是在已经采样的结果...

2020-04-26 18:12:25 1105 1

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(6)周所学知识(001)

重要性采样在上面的采样中我们是按照后验概率进行采样的,但是,后验概率我们也不知道呀,经过非线性非高斯处理后,谁知道后验概率的PDF是啥。所以,我们要找一个我们知道的PDF进行采样,这一步找合适的PDF就是重要性采样。...

2020-04-22 22:16:44 652

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(5)周所学知识

若由本篇博文增加关注,就解封本篇博文的VIP权限哈,记得在下方留言哈本周进行了PF-TBD的研究。Firstly,先别说什么是基于粒子滤波的检测前跟踪,你要先知道什么是粒子滤波法吧。下面我将把基本的粒子滤波步骤说一下。首先,把下面的几句话读一下:先耐着性子把我的博文完完整整地读一遍,有些我没让你去看而你又不知道的知识点,别忙着去查。因为粒子滤波算法推导说麻烦还是有点麻烦的,如果你刚看了几句...

2020-04-19 18:10:34 1380 6

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(4)周所学知识

若由本篇博文增加关注,就解封本篇博文的VIP权限哈,记得在下方留言哈本周我基本完成了DP-TBD的算法编程。本篇文章将详细阐述编程的过程。首先进行径向与切向的分辨单元的初始化,对于值函数的初始化,以及定义状态和状态转移。X=zeros(ss,K); %状态I=zeros(K); %各帧状态对应的值函数S=zeros(K); %存储各帧之间的状态转移关系Nx=100; %径向距...

2020-04-11 22:59:05 1562 3

原创 Pycharm,Anaconda3与Github相关问题(绝对干货!)

最近搞了一下图片to latex公式,其中有些问题在这里记录一下,中间肯定有很多的信息对你有用:先上个Anaconda的快速下载链接,因为官网下载真滴慢呀anaconda与python对应的版本(更新至2020.3.12):Python2.7Python3.4Python3.5Python3.6Python3.7Python3.83.4.32.7....

2020-04-06 12:46:26 947

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(3)周所学知识

若由本篇博文增加关注,就解封本篇博文的VIP权限哈,记得在下方留言哈这周我详细把动态规划的步骤又过了几遍,这为这周的DP-TBD编程打了很好的基础。首先,你要明确DP-TBD具有状态这一大块,和观测这一大块。这是十分重要的,因为在编程时,需要分为这两部分进行编程。因此,我们要了解DP-TND的系统模型与量测模型。假设雷达是在x-y这个二维平面上进行量测的。且假设目标是进行匀速直线的。...

2020-04-05 17:55:32 1871 2

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(2)周所学知识(02)

等粉丝数突破30,我将解封本系列的VIP权限哈!本篇文章将开始进行DP-TBD。首先你需要了解什么是DP即动态规划,而不是急于去找什么是DP-TBD。动态规划是一种最优化的思想,DP-TBD是在这种思想上发展起来的。为了能够深入了解什么是动态规划,你首先必须要掌握以下三点:Viterbi(维特比)算法多阶段决策HMM这三点你必须要好好百度一下看看相关知识,这对于下面了解动态规划很重要...

2020-03-28 18:14:14 1397 1

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(2)周所学知识(01)

等粉丝数突破30,我将解封本系列的VIP权限哈!在本周我将上周的代码又完整的检查了一遍,发现我在生成H矩阵时累加的不是能量,而是数量,即相同ρ与相同角度的个数。先说明一下,其实先进行初级滤波然后再进行累加相同的个数与不进行初级滤波直接进行能量的累加效果是大差不差的。在进行初级滤波时,已经滤除了一些噪声,这与进行能量的累加其实是相似的。但是为了充分说明检测前跟踪是利用观测数据的大部分数据这一性质...

2020-03-27 20:07:23 1414 2

原创 (从零开始)基于检测前跟踪雷达目标跟踪技术的研究:第(1)周所学知识

本项目目前使用的回波数据集是2019年的一份公开数据集,链接如下雷达回波序列中弱小飞机目标检测跟踪数据集本周我做的是SHT-TBD,我参考了这篇西电的硕士论文,论文中算法思路比较详细,文中有二维霍夫变换以及三维霍夫变换,我采取的是二维霍夫变换。我在这一周完成了SHT-TBD的大部分工作。由于对于SHT-TBD检测直线,且回波数据不一定是直线,所以我采用短时局部的检测。在此雷达数据集中,所有...

2020-03-21 21:52:20 4870 22

原创 对于论文2D PCA的理解与复现

1.论文中开始讲述了ICA与核PCA优于PCA但时间用的较多,时间平均比为8.7:3.2:1.10。以及PCA的缺点:因为二维图像矩阵转化为一维矩阵,同时训练样本较少,故会生成难以准确评估的协方差矩阵。2.接着开始引入2DPCA:开始时,以Y=AX引入基的概念,然后由于只取一个最优的投影方向是表达不了这么多数据信息的,因此采用了前d个最大特征值所对应的特征向量作为d个投影基。接着便讲述了用2D...

2020-03-17 13:03:55 1814

原创 检测前目标跟踪在雷达系统中的应用(一):DBT与TBD

检测前目标跟踪(TBD)检测前跟踪(trace-before-detect,TBD)是针对于目标的检测跟踪提出的。传统的检测跟踪是检测后跟踪(trace-after-detect,TAD),对于TAD,它是直接采用低门限或者无门限处理的的传感器的原始观测数据,然后进行数据信息的挖掘,通过在时间上的观测积累,提高信噪比,以此达到对于目标的跟踪,在高的信噪比下TAD的检测效果较好。但是对于信噪比较低...

2020-02-14 15:51:31 6981 2

原创 常规雷达信号软件仿真平台设计

常规雷达信号软件仿真平台设计雷达仿真技术经过三十多年的发展和研究,已经成为雷达研究和使用中必备的基础工具。雷达信号仿真是电子战威胁环境仿真的关键技术之一。本课题主要讨论的是雷达信号仿真部分,并结合一些常见的雷达信号处理系统的实例来说明Matlab软件在雷达信号处理系统仿真中的应用。一、课题研究现状计算机辅助分析和设计技术发展十分迅速,出现了大量实用仿真软件与工具,并应用于信号调制建模,分析和...

2020-01-04 16:17:26 9034 3

原创 PCA与2DPCA及2D-2DPCA零基础理解(上)

首先要知道为什么PCA是什么,为什么要用PCA。PCA即主成分分析,例如对于一幅图像,要表示它,可以用他的主要部分表示即可,这样可以降低在图像处理中的数据处理难度,例如可以降低数据的存储容量。那么,什么样的方法能够降低数据处理难度呢,降维便是一种很好的方法,这就引出了PCA(通过降维达到获取主要部分即主成分分析)。为了避免将知识分散开讲,最后还是云里雾里的,我现在将PCA的大致步骤讲一下:由于...

2018-12-02 22:37:53 7227 4

原创 脏读,不可重复读,幻读是什么,事务的隔离级和它们有什么关系

事务隔离级别

2022-11-28 20:11:21 238 1

原创 数据库中事务、回滚是啥意思?

回滚:撤销对于数据库做的操作,回到开始的状态。事务:针对数据库所做的一系列顺序操作。特性:原子性,一致性,隔离性,持久性。

2022-11-28 19:56:04 1117

原创 流量控制与拥塞控制

流量控制与拥塞控制

2022-11-28 19:35:38 200

原创 TCP与UDP的区别

TCP:面向连接,可靠的,基于字节流的一对一通信传输,具有拥塞控制,使用于文件传输等可靠传输。UDP:无连接,可靠传输,基于报文,可一对一,一对多,多对一的通信传输,使用于实时传输。

2022-11-28 19:30:19 430

原创 malloc与new的区别,free与delete的区别

new、malloc、delete、free辨析

2022-11-28 16:56:21 176

原创 进程是什么?线程是什么?有什么区别?进程之间的通信方式?线程共享什么?线程同步方式?

进程、线程辨析

2022-11-28 16:22:29 87

原创 死锁是什么?有什么条件?怎样处理?

死锁相关知识

2022-11-28 15:55:30 405

原创 C++基类指针与派生类指针的转换原则

C++基类指针与子类指针的转化

2022-11-25 15:36:01 418

原创 C/C++的struct的区别

C/C++中的struct的区别

2022-11-25 15:30:26 326

原创 C++ map与unordered_map

map与unordered_map的区别

2022-11-25 15:23:40 416

原创 C++哪些函数不能成为虚函数

C++哪些函数不能成为虚函数

2022-11-23 20:59:32 87

原创 C++静态绑定、动态绑定;静态编译、动态编译;静态链接、动态链接;静态联编、静态联编

C++中静态与动态的相关信息解析

2022-11-23 20:51:53 198

原创 C++ 构造函数与析构函数的执行顺序

C++构造函数与析构函数的执行顺序

2022-11-23 20:02:31 160

原创 C++中预处理、编译、汇编、链接的区别

预处理,编译,汇编,链接阶段的区别

2022-11-23 19:29:43 694

原创 C++四种强制类型转换

四种强制类型转换(显式)

2022-11-23 12:10:23 83

原创 C++中所有的构造函数

构造函数的作用:为了初始化对象的数据成员,实例化对象。

2022-11-23 11:59:05 111

原创 C++ 构造函数 重载问题

已重载构造函数,且重载的构造函数形参列表参数无初始化值,想要使用默认构造函数,必须显式写出默认构造函数错误示例:正确示例:已重载构造函数,且重载的构造函数形参列表参数无初始化值。实例化对象时,对象不跟括号,则使用默认构造函数;对象跟括号且形参赋值,则使用重载构造函数实例化对象1:实例化对象2:已重载构造函数,且重载的构造函数形参列表参数有初始化值。实例化对象时,只能使用重载构造函数错误示例:正确示例:已重载构造函数,且重载的构造函数形参列表部分参数有初始化值,则最后一个形参必须.

2022-01-11 00:09:58 716

原创 C++ python语法对照(1)

基本数据类型:pythoni = 10print(type(i))C++#include <iostream>using namespace std;int main() { int i = 0; cout << typeid(i).name()<< endl;}for循环:python for i in range(1,10): print(i)C++#include <iostream>usi

2021-08-28 19:15:56 372

原创 Anaconda搭建python虚拟环境

不同项目可能需要不同运行虚拟环境,所以新建虚拟环境十分有必要找到Anaconda Prompt一般在Windows10下直接搜就可以直接搜到查看Anaconda已经搭建了几个环境输入命令行"conda env list",查看Anaconda下有几个环境,"base"是Anaconda基础自带的环境新建运行环境输入命令行"conda create -n 虚拟环境名字 python=X.X"激活刚刚创建的虚拟环境,命令行输入"conda activate 虚拟环境名字"此

2021-07-03 18:41:58 264

原创 Anaconda与Pycharm的辨析

Anaconda与Pycharm的辨析Anaconda是python文件的一个包管理器,可以用它下载python文件的相关库和包,制作成python编程所需要的环境(模块、包、库)Pycharm是python文件的集成开发环境,在Pycharm上可以进行python文件的开发与调试,像Visual Studio之于C++,Eclipse之于Java。Pycharm里面也有下载python文件的相关库和包的功能,但很多库和包Pycharm可能因为网络及版本问题不能下载安装故Pycharm和Anacon

2021-07-03 18:11:35 4567

原创 Pycharm导入Anaconda配置的虚拟环境步骤

打开自己的项目进入以下界面点击左上角"File"——》“Settings”进入以下界面,并按照图中的顺序点击4.在上图的红框中找到你的Anaconda安装的位置,在安装位置中找到envs——》环境名字(这里用opencv4)——》点击python.exe,然后一直点击"OK"即可。到此Pycharm导入Anaconda搭建的环境完毕...

2021-07-03 18:07:45 2126

原创 python模块、库、包辨析

模块:就是一个.py文件,里面包括封装好的多个函数库:多个模块的集合包:为了方面管理模块等文件,将多个文件打包,包的结构中第一个文件是_init_.py

2021-07-03 17:38:10 103

原创 Python中的括号辨析

列表:方括号 [ ]字典:花括号 { }元组和表达式:圆括号 ( )

2021-03-10 21:51:59 137

原创 json文件的批量转化(亲测有效)

在进行图像分割时,我们需要自备数据集,一般选择labelme进行图像的标注,在标注过后我们会得到很多的json文件。一般我们可以使用labelme自带的脚本文件将其转化为图像格式,即:激活labelme的环境运行labelme_json_to_dataset <文件名>.json,例如:labelme_json_to_dataset test.json但是这里仅仅对于一个json文件进行。一般的需要大量的数据集,所以这时我们采用以下方法进行json文件的批量转化。注意:请在用label

2021-01-04 21:09:42 2953 2

原创 sudo: vim: command not found解决办法

sudo rm /var/lib/dpkg/lock* sudo apt-get update && sudo apt-get install vim

2020-11-25 22:32:46 15793 10

原创 ubuntu下解压缩.zip,.tar,.tar.gz,.tar.bz2

格式压缩示例解压示例.zipzip -r archive_name.zip directory_to_compress想把文件夹pictures压缩为image.zip:zip -r image.zip picturesunzip archive_name.zip解压image.zip:unzip image.zip.tartar -cvf archive_name.tar directory_to_compress想把文件夹pictures压缩为image.ta...

2020-10-24 19:52:55 167

lena图数据集.zip

lena图对于搞图像处理的人来说,应该及其熟悉了,这里准备了128*128,256*256,512*512的单通道和三通道图片,均为官网上的图片

2020-09-13

Optical time-stretch imaging: Principles and applications

本文为光学时间拉伸成像的原理及应用的文章,请参考我的文章https://blog.csdn.net/qq_40287633/article/details/106768614

2020-06-15

Internet Download Manager更新安装时间

本资源是对于Internet Download Manager所提供的资源,更新Internet Download Manager的安装时间,双击安装即可。

2020-05-30

ORL人脸识别数据集

突然发现ORL数据集的网站进不去了,我想到我的电脑里还有备份,就想着在这里分享给大家,数据集中一共有40个人的人脸,每个人十张人脸图像。均为灰度图像,大小为92×112。

2020-03-27

基于实测雷达回波数据的检测前跟踪算法实现.pdf

本资源可配合我的博文https://editor.csdn.net/md?articleId=105017689使用,在博文中详细阐述了实现的步骤以及相关知识点。本资源是一篇西安电子科技大学的硕士论文,文中详细阐释了SHT-TBD,PF-TBD的原理算法步骤等,尤其是算法步骤比较清晰,故我上传此资源供大家参考。

2020-03-21

粒子滤波算法相关文献.zip

这四篇文献是我精心地找的关于粒子滤波的文献,绝对干货。这四篇文献从最基础的到后来慢慢深入,发表时间分别是09,14,16,18年。

2020-03-17

python,PCA重构人脸子图像,2D-PCA,2D-2DPCA相关代码.zip

在本文档中包含有python,PCA重构人脸子图像,2D-PCA,2D-2DPCA相关代码,本代码配合博客文章https://blog.csdn.net/qq_40287633/article/details/104919330

2020-03-17

常规雷达信号软件仿真平台设计(在下面的描述里已添加缺少文件).zip

首先非常抱歉里面缺少了GUI.fig文件,谢谢大家指正,这里附上缺少文件的链接:链接:链接:链接:https://pan.baidu.com/s/1YuF47UelZUo2E76QH8UKBw 提取码:q3om 本资源在研究了信号调制原理的基础上,结合战场上更复杂的环境,使用matlab(R2014a)编程软件编写了AM、FM、LFM、QPSK信号生成代码。模拟战场对雷达信号进行了加噪以及调制信号的相互混合处理,在实验过程中使用matlab编写了一个GUI界面展示对应的仿真结果。 该仿真设计基本满足以下设计要求: (1)设计一个GUI界面,能仿真出一些常见的雷达信号,可以在界面上设置参数来仿真不同类型的信号。 (2)能够把任意的信号进行混合叠加,得到它们对应的时域图。 (3)可以在界面上加入白噪声,设计出不同信噪比下的信号以及相应的时域图。 (4)设计不同的脉冲间隔方式,包括固定间隔、逐步递进、正弦间隔等三种间隔方式。

2020-01-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除